WebAgain the molar mass of a chemical says how many grams are contained within 1 mole of that chemical. So we can take our mole number from before and multiply it by the molar mass: 0.00625 mol x (45.4622 g/1 mol) = 0.27788875 g. Accounting for sig figs the answer is properly reported as 0.28 grams of beryllium chloride. Webmolar mass = 55.8 g/mol. mass = 55.8 × 0.10 = 5.58 g. Moles from masses. WebAug 12, 2024 · As we just discussed, molar mass is defined as the mass (in grams) of 1 mole of substance (or Avogadro's number of molecules or formula units). The simplest type of manipulation using molar mass as a conversion factor is a mole-gram conversion (or its reverse, a gram-mole conversion). WebThe molar mass of a substance is the mass in grams of 1 mole of the substance. As shown in this video, we can obtain a substance's molar mass by summing the molar masses of its component atoms. We can then use the calculated molar mass to convert between mass and number of moles of the substance.
